L’utilisation de la ligne de commande au quotidien nécessite rapidement d’avoir plusieurs terminaux ouverts simultannément. Sous des environnement granphiques (gnome, kde, …), on peut ouvrir en parallèle plusieurs fenêtres, utiliser des packages spécifiques commme terminator, ou passer par le package screen.

screen-split
screen-split

Je retien cette dernière solution, par habitude (les autres n’ont pas de plus value me poussant au changement), mais aussi parce que screen se retrouve aisément sur de nombreux autres OS et sur les serveur n’ayant pas d’enironnement X.

Manuel de survie de screen en mode split

Voici la liste des commandes utiles permettant l’ajout de plusieurs panneaux et leur utilisation minimale :

  • Couper son écran verticalement: Ctrl+a puis |
  • Couper son écran horizontalement: Ctrl+a puis S
  • Supprimmer la séparation et revenir à un seul écran : Ctrl+a puis Q
  • Passer d’un écran à l’autre: Ctrl+a puis tab

A noter qu’à l’ouverture d’un nouvel écran, on se retrouve dans un screen vierge, et donc qu’il faudra en initialiser un avec Ctrl+a puis c.

Commandes de base de screen

Pour les débutants avec screen, en mode survie, sont à connaitre les commandes suivantes :

  • Nouveau terminal screen: Ctrl+a puis c
  • Terminal suivant: Ctrl+a puis n
  • Terminal précédent: Ctrl+a puis p
  • Switch de terminal via une liste explicite: Ctrl+a puis "